Registry Functions

Main Areas of Registry Administration

RWISR is structured to support core vessel registration and registry administration functions.

Provisional Registration

Initial registration processing for eligible vessels subject to submission and review of required documentation.

Permanent Registration

Permanent registry processing following compliance with applicable documentary and administrative requirements.

Bareboat Registration

Bareboat registration procedures, where applicable, subject to legal and documentary conditions.

Ownership & Mortgage Recording

Administrative recording support related to ownership documentation and mortgage registration matters.

Certificates & Endorsements

Registry-related administration concerning statutory documentation, endorsements, and certificate records.
